Ordinals
beta
Address bc1q85a83k40ep0k9kqwdfp0k9d8c36wvp7xk0dpj7
sat balance
995080
runes balances
outputs
9ca97ac4187071a523d71123398a07265a5ad02607f9a0645226301c7a3c50d6:0